SF 970 Senate Long Description

1E Relating to elections; providing for and defining early voting; requiring municipal clerks to receive training from secretary of state before administering early voting; modifying hours county auditors and municipal clerks accept absentee ballot applications and allow the casting of absentee ballots; prescribing early voting balloting procedure; specifying a time period for early voting; prescribing hours and locations for early voting; requiring the county auditor to post days, times and locations of early voting a certain number of days before voting begins; specifying voting procedures; requiring the recording of votes in the statewide voter registration system; requiring early voting rosters be marked by beginning of election day; prescribing ballot storage and counting procedures; requiring person voting early to sign roster; specifying roster ballot statement; requiring the testing of early voting equipment a certain number of days before election; requiring early ballots counted centrally to be considered a precinct; repealing provision regarding the delivery of absentee ballots to hospital patients and residents of health care facilities who are eligible voters and who have applied for absentee ballots; specifying certain criteria the secretary of state must certify before early voting authorization becomes effective
